State of Illinois Stop-gap Funding Benefits Illinois Tech MAP Recipients

Illinois Tech is pleased that Governor Bruce Rauner signed a bill passed by the Illinois General Assembly that provides partial funding for higher education for the current fiscal year, which began July 1, 2015. As a result, Illinois Tech will be receiving partial payment on the 2015-16 MAP grants that the Illinois Student Assistance Commission awarded to eligible students. Illinois Tech expects to receive an amount equal to the MAP grant funding that had been awarded for the fall 2015 semester.

Additionally, Illinois Tech will cancel the implementation of the MAP Grant Replacement Loans for those students who elected to participate in this institutional loan program.

In the coming days, the Office of Financial Aid will be working directly with student recipients of the MAP Grants to address specific questions regarding individual student accounts.

Illinois Tech remains hopeful that the state will eventually appropriate the remaining MAP Grant funds for the spring 2016 semester. We will continue to remain active in Springfield, urging our state representatives to fulfill their promise to our students before the fall 2016 semester begins, and we will continue to communicate with you as we receive additional information.
